Important vs Significant

Important and Significant are two words that are often confused when it comes to their usage and meanings. Strictly speaking, there is some difference between the two words. The word ‘important’ is used in the sense of ‘essential’. On the other hand, the word ‘significant’ is used in the sense of ‘noteworthy’. This is the subtle difference between the two words.

It is interesting to note that the word ‘important’ is used chiefly as an adjective as in the expressions ‘important news’ and ‘important person’. It has its noun form in the word ‘importance’. On the other hand, the word ‘significant’ is also chiefly used as an adjective as in the expressions ‘significant point’ and ‘significant person’. The word ‘significant’ has its noun form in the word ‘significance’.

Take a look at the sentences given below

1. Robert has spoken of a few important issues in the meeting.

2. Lucy is an important person in the group.

In both the sentences given above, the word ‘important’ is used in the sense of ‘essential’ or ‘crucial’. Hence, the first sentence can be rewritten as ‘Robert has spoken of a few essential issues in the meeting’, and the meaning of the second sentence would be ‘Lucy is a crucial person in the group’.

Observe the two sentences

1. Robert made significant changes in the agenda.

2. Angela voiced out significant points in the discussion.

In both the sentences, you can find that the word ‘significant’ is used in the sense of ‘noteworthy’ and hence, the first sentence could be rewritten as ‘Robert made noteworthy changes in the agenda’, and the second sentence could be rewritten as ‘Angela voiced out noteworthy points in the discussion’. These are the important differences between the two words, namely, important and significant.
